Assessing Lawyer Experience
When choosing a criminal defense attorney, assessing their experience is critical. You'll want to dive deep into their previous instances to comprehend not just the amount of instances they have actually handled, however the quality of results accomplished.
It's not practically for how long they've been exercising, however how well they have actually dealt with cases comparable to your own. Search for specifics: Have they handled fees like yours prior to? The amount of of those situations mosted likely to test, and what were the results?
It's important you know they have actually got a solid performance history with effective results in circumstances similar to what you're dealing with. Experience in a court room is especially invaluable if your instance mosts likely to trial. You don't simply want a person that recognizes the law; you require a person that maneuvers effectively within the court room dynamics.
Furthermore, inspect where they've obtained their experience. Somebody that's familiar with the neighborhood courts and courts can be helpful. They'll comprehend local treatments and subtleties which can play an important role in the defense technique.
Selecting someone experienced can make all the distinction. Ensure their experience lines up very closely with your needs, giving you the most effective chance at a beneficial end result.
Examining Communication Abilities
Evaluating interaction skills is necessary when picking a criminal defense attorney. You'll desire somebody who not just speaks plainly but additionally listens efficiently. Your attorney should make you really feel comprehended and make sure that you grasp every facet of your situation.
Look for an attorney that can discuss complicated lawful terms in uncomplicated language. They need to be friendly, making it simple for you to ask concerns and express concerns. Notification exactly how they interact throughout your initial examination. Are they person? Do they offer detailed solutions or rush via descriptions?
Great interaction also means staying in touch. Your attorney should upgrade you routinely concerning your instance's progression. Check if they favor emails, telephone call, or in person meetings and see if their recommended method straightens with your needs.
Last but not least, consider their ability to connect under pressure. Courtroom setups are high-stress environments, and you require somebody that can express your defense clearly and convincingly before a judge and jury.
Request for examples of exactly how they have actually handled difficult instances or circumstances in the past.
Understanding Defense Methods
Understanding the numerous defense methods your lawyer might use is crucial to effectively navigating your case. Each approach hinges on the specifics of the charges you're dealing with and the evidence versus you. Allow's delve into what you require to understand.
To begin with, if there's a lack of proof, your lawyer could argue that the prosecution hasn't fulfilled its burden of proof. Keep in mind, it's not your task to show virtue; it's the district attorney's work to verify regret beyond a reasonable question. If they can't, you ought to be acquitted.
An additional typical technique is self-defense, specifically in cases involving costs like attack or murder. Sometimes, your protection might entail doubting the validity of exactly how evidence was gotten. If police broke your rights during the examination, proof may be subdued, which can substantially compromise the prosecution's situation.
Finally, your lawyer might negotiate an appeal offer if it offers your best interest. This typically happens if the proof against you is solid however there are mitigating factors that might bring about decreased charges or sentencing.
Comprehending these strategies aids you discuss your case better with your attorney.
